Baltimore Orioles vs New York Yankees
Scoring summary
| INN | BATTER | PLAY | SCORE |
|---|---|---|---|
| B1 | Cody Bellinger | Cody Bellinger doubles (5) on a sharp line drive to right fielder Dylan Beavers. Aaron Judge scores. Cody Bellinger to 3rd. | BAL 0, NYY 1 |
| T2 | Pete Alonso | Pete Alonso homers (5) on a fly ball to right field. | BAL 1, NYY 1 |
| B2 | José Caballero | José Caballero homers (4) on a fly ball to left field. | BAL 1, NYY 2 |
| B2 | Ben Rice | Ben Rice homers (11) on a line drive to right center field. Trent Grisham scores. Paul Goldschmidt scores. | BAL 1, NYY 5 |
| T7 | Dylan Beavers | Dylan Beavers grounds out softly, pitcher Fernando Cruz to first baseman Paul Goldschmidt. Pete Alonso scores. Samuel Basallo to 3rd. | BAL 2, NYY 5 |
| B7 | Amed Rosario | Amed Rosario singles on a line drive to center fielder Leody Taveras. Aaron Judge scores. Cody Bellinger to 2nd. | BAL 2, NYY 6 |
| B8 | Aaron Judge | Aaron Judge singles on a ground ball to center fielder Leody Taveras. Austin Wells scores. Ben Rice to 2nd. | BAL 2, NYY 7 |

How RunsLeft analyzes games
Standard content on this page comes from the MLB Stats API. The pitching analysis describes how the game was pitched — the starter's line, the bullpen sequence and each arm's role (opener, bulk, setup, closer), pitch counts as a fatigue signal, and the leverage context where the game turned. Reliever roles are inferred from how the manager used each arm up to that date. It describes structure and constraints; it does not grade the manager.
